What happened in first microsecond of Big Bang?

By recreating the first matter in history, a new study provides a piece of the puzzle

Copenhagen: Researchers at the University of Copenhagen — Faculty of Science have investigated what happened to a specific kind of plasma — the first matter ever to be present — during the first microsecond of the Big Bang. Their findings provide a piece of the puzzle to the evolution of the universe, as people know it today.

About 14 billion years ago, our universe changed from being a lot hotter and denser to expanding radically — a process that scientists have named ‘The Big Bang’. And even though we know that this fast expansion created particles, atoms, stars, galaxies and life as we know it today, the details of how it all happened are still unknown.


Now, a new study performed by researchers from the University of Copenhagen reveals insights into how it all began.

“We have studied a substance called Quark-Gluon Plasma that was the only matter, which existed during the first microsecond of Big Bang. Our results tell us a unique story of how the plasma evolved in the early stage of the universe,” explains You Zhou, Associate Professor at the Niels Bohr Institute, University of Copenhagen.

“First the plasma that consisted of quarks and gluons was separated by the hot expansion of the universe. Then the pieces of quark reformed into so-called hadrons. A hadron with three quarks makes a proton, which is part of atomic cores. These cores are the building blocks that constitute earth, ourselves and the universe that surrounds us,” he adds.

The Quark-Gluon Plasma (QGP) was present in the first 0.000001 seconds of the Big Bang and thereafter it disappeared because of the expansion.

But by using the Large Hadron Collider at CERN, researchers were able to recreate this first matter in history and trace back what happened to it.

“The collider smashes together ions from the plasma with great velocity — almost like the speed of light. This makes us able to see how the QGP evolved from being its own matter to the cores in atoms and the building blocks of life,” says You Zhou.
